Wings For Life Usa - Spinal Cord Research Foundation Inc
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2017 | 1,442,297 | 1,183,567 | 258,730 | 2.6 | 0% |
| 2018 | 2,671,681 | 1,044,798 | 1,626,883 | 21.7 | 0% |
| 2019 | 3,914,787 | 3,764,376 | 150,411 | 6.5 | 0% |
| 2020 | 2,828,596 | 519,867 | 2,308,729 | 100.3 | 0% |
| 2021 | 4,978,629 | 4,790,788 | 187,841 | 11.4 | 0% |
| 2022 | 5,591,020 | 1,141,298 | 4,449,722 | 94.4 | 0% |
| 2023 | 5,779,508 | 5,128,442 | 651,066 | 22.5 | 0%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ization brought in $651,066 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 22.5 months of spending, up from 2.6 in 2017. Staff pay was 0% of spending.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2023.
